My Oracle Support Banner

X1-PUDSD Issue-NullPointerException When Override IDs Are Populated (Doc ID 2996823.1)

Last updated on JANUARY 09, 2024

Applies to:

Oracle Utilities Customer Cloud Service - Version 22B and later
Information in this document applies to any platform.

Goal

X1-PUDSD batch job encounters NullPointerException when override ID paremeters are populated.
 
Caused by: java.lang.NullPointerException
at com.splwg.base.api.batch.AbstractThreadWorker.findLowIdForJob(AbstractThreadWorker.java:1084)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.findLowIdForJob(AbstractThreadWorker.java:1072)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.getLowIdForJob(AbstractThreadWorker.java:1028)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.getLowIdForThread(AbstractThreadWorker.java:985)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.getLowIdForThread(AbstractThreadWorker.java:958)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.initForThreadIteration(AbstractThreadWorker.java:610)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.startResultRowQueryIteratorForThread(AbstractThreadWorker.java:602)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.PluginDrivenProcessWrapper.setupIdForQueryIterator(PluginDrivenProcessWrapper.java:63)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.domain.batch.pluginDriven.PluginDrivenThreadHelper.initializeThreadWork(PluginDrivenThreadHelper.java:125)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.domain.batch.pluginDriven.PluginDrivenGenericThreadIterationWorker.initializeThreadWork(PluginDrivenGenericThreadIterationWorker.java:31)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ractThreadWorker.initializeThreadWork(AbstractThreadWorker.java:561)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.ThreadIterationStrategy.doInitialization(ThreadIterationStrategy.java:79)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ractCommitStrategy.concreteExecuteWork(AbstractCommitStrategy.java:76)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.ThreadIterationStrategy.concreteExecuteWork(ThreadIterationStrategy.java:63)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.AbstractExecutionStrategy.executeWork(AbstractExecutionStrategy.java:290)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.ThreadWorkerExecuteUnitWrapper.executeWork(ThreadWorkerExecuteUnitWrapper.java:105)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.api.batch.ThreadWorkerExecuteUnitWrapper.executeWrappedWork(ThreadWorkerExecuteUnitWrapper.java:58) ~[spl-base-4.5.0.0.0.jar:?]
at com.splwg.base.support.batch.JavaBatchWork.executeThreadWork(JavaBatchWork.java:123) ~[spl-base-4.5.0.0.0.jar:?]
... 19 more
 

Solution

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Goal
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.